通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

开发费用怎么制作

开发费用怎么制作

如何制定开发费用?

制定开发费用需要考虑的因素包括:项目的复杂性、开发时间、开发团队的规模和经验、技术难度、需求的变更、以及后期的维护和更新等。 这些因素都会直接影响到开发费用的总额。其中,项目的复杂性和开发时间是开发费用最重要的两个决定因素,它们决定了你需要投入多少资源和时间来完成开发任务。

接下来,我们将详细解释如何根据以上因素来制定开发费用。

一、项目的复杂性

项目的复杂性是影响开发费用的首要因素。简单的项目,比如一个基础的网站或者应用,其开发费用会相对较低。然而,如果项目需要复杂的功能,如用户管理系统、电子商务功能、社交网络功能等,那么开发费用就会相对较高。此外,项目的设计要求也会影响到开发费用。高级的设计和用户体验需要更多的时间和专业知识,因此也会增加开发费用。

二、开发时间

开发时间是另一个主要的决定因素。一般来说,开发时间越长,开发费用就越高。这是因为开发时间长意味着需要投入更多的资源,包括人力、物力和财力。开发团队需要在项目开始之前进行详细的计划,预估项目的开发时间,并根据这个预估来制定开发费用。

三、开发团队的规模和经验

开发团队的规模和经验也会直接影响到开发费用。一般来说,团队越大,经验越丰富,其开发费用就越高。这是因为大团队和经验丰富的团队能够提供更高质量的服务,包括更高的开发效率、更少的错误和更好的用户体验。然而,这并不意味着你应该总是选择最大和最有经验的团队。你应该根据项目的需要和预算来选择合适的团队。

四、技术难度

技术难度也是决定开发费用的一个重要因素。如果项目需要使用到尖端的技术,或者需要解决复杂的技术问题,那么开发费用就会相对较高。反之,如果项目只需要使用基础的技术,那么开发费用就会相对较低。

五、需求的变更

需求的变更可能会增加开发费用。这是因为需求的变更可能会导致开发团队需要重新规划和开发项目,这将消耗更多的时间和资源。因此,你应该尽量在项目开始之前明确需求,避免在开发过程中频繁变更需求。

六、后期的维护和更新

后期的维护和更新也会增加开发费用。这是因为,一旦项目上线,你就需要定期维护和更新项目,以保证项目的稳定运行和用户体验。这些维护和更新工作需要消耗时间和资源,因此也会增加开发费用。

总的来说,制定开发费用是一个复杂的过程,需要考虑多种因素。你需要根据项目的具体情况和需求,来制定合理的开发费用。

相关问答FAQs:

1. 什么是开发费用?
开发费用是指在产品或项目开发过程中所需投入的资金,用于支付人员工资、购买设备和材料等开发相关的费用。

2. 开发费用的制作包括哪些方面?
开发费用的制作主要包括以下几个方面:人力资源费用、设备和工具费用、材料和供应费用、测试和验证费用以及项目管理费用等。这些费用都是为了保证开发过程的顺利进行而产生的。

3. 如何制作开发费用预算?
制作开发费用预算需要进行以下几个步骤:首先,明确开发项目的目标和需求;然后,确定所需的人力资源、设备和材料等;接着,估算每个方面的费用,并制定详细的费用预算表;最后,对费用预算进行审核和调整,确保预算的合理性和准确性。

4. 开发费用如何控制和降低?
要控制和降低开发费用,可以采取以下几个方法:首先,合理安排人力资源,避免人力浪费;其次,选择合适的设备和工具,避免过度投资;另外,优化材料和供应链,降低成本;最后,进行有效的项目管理,减少资源浪费和时间成本。通过这些措施,可以有效控制和降低开发费用。

相关文章